Typical Window Issues and Their Solutions
Before diving into the repair process, it's important to recognize the specific problems you're handling. Here are some typical window issues and their solutions:
Cracked or Broken Glass
- Symptoms: Visible cracks or shattered glass.
- Solution: Replace the glass pane. This can be done by eliminating the damaged glass, cleaning the frame, and placing a brand-new pane. Expert installation is recommended for larger or more complicated windows.
Leaking Windows
- Signs: Drafts, water stains, and wetness around the window frame.
- Solution: Seal the gaps with weatherstripping, caulking, or foam tape. Replacing the window may be essential if the damage is substantial.
Sticking or Hard-to-Open Windows
- Symptoms: Difficulty in opening or closing the window.
- Service: Lubricate the window tracks with a silicone-based lubricant. If the issue persists, look for deformed or broken frames and consider professional repair or replacement.
Decomposed or Damaged Wood Frames
- Signs: Soft, decayed, or damaged wood around the window.
- Option: Repair or replace the afflicted wood. Use wood filler for minor damage, or consider a complete frame replacement for severe cases.
foggy window repair or Cloudy Insulated Glass
- Symptoms: Condensation or fog in between the glass panes.
- Service: Replace the whole glass unit. This is a complex job and usually needs expert assistance.
Step-by-Step Guide to Window Repair
Assess the Damage
- Identify the type and level of the damage. Figure out whether you can deal with the repair yourself or if it's best to call a professional.
- Collect essential tools and products, such as a screwdriver, putty knife, replacement glass, caulking, and weatherstripping.
Security First
- Use protective gloves and goggles to prevent injury.
- If you are dealing with a high window, use a tough ladder and have somebody assist you.
Get Rid Of the Damaged Glass (if appropriate)
- Carefully eliminate any broken glass from the frame. Use a putty knife to pry out the old putty and glazing points.
- Tidy the frame thoroughly to guarantee a smooth surface area for the brand-new glass.
Install the New Glass
- Place the new glass pane into the frame, ensuring it is centered and safe and secure.
- Apply new putty around the edges of the glass and insert glazing points to hold it in location.
- Enable the putty to dry according to the manufacturer's guidelines.
Seal and Insulate
- Apply weatherstripping or caulking around the window frame to prevent air leakages and water damage.
- Look for any spaces or cracks and seal them appropriately.
Check the Window
- Open and close the window to guarantee it runs efficiently.
- Look for any draft or moisture concerns and address them as needed.
Keep Regularly
- Tidy the windows and frames frequently to prevent accumulation and wear.
- Examine the windows for any signs of damage or wear during routine upkeep.

Frequently Asked Questions About House Window Repair
Q: Can I repair a split window myself?
- A: Yes, for small cracks, you can use a clear epoxy resin to the crack to prevent it from spreading out. Nevertheless, for bigger cracks or shattered glass, it is best to replace the entire pane, which may need professional assistance.
Q: How typically should I examine my windows?
- A: It is recommended to inspect your windows a minimum of once a year, preferably throughout the spring and fall. Routine inspections can help you catch and attend to problems before they end up being significant problems.
Q: Are all kinds of windows repairable?
- A: Most window types can be fixed, however some may need specific techniques or products. For instance, vinyl windows might need specific tools for removing and changing parts, while wood windows may need more extensive repairs.
Q: What is the distinction between weatherstripping and caulking?
- A: Weatherstripping is a material applied to the edges of a window to produce a seal and prevent drafts. Caulking, on the other hand, is a sealant utilized to fill spaces and cracks in the window frame, assisting to avoid water and air leakages.
Q: How can I prevent window damage?
- A: Regular upkeep, such as cleansing, lubricating, and sealing, can help prevent window damage. Additionally, prevent putting heavy objects near windows, and make sure that window screens are in great condition to protect against accidental effects.
Q: Is it cost-effective to repair windows?
- A: In many cases, fixing a window is more cost-effective than changing it. However, if the damage is extensive or if the window is older, replacement may be the better alternative.
